Output 88e86b33c23d521508bf45a15c42935bb160a5ac602e03b30cd73401ad808e4e:67

value
313968
script pubkey
OP_0 OP_PUSHBYTES_32 58a0577c1f52be005eb72b9126b5f18d8d2f652f89057809eaef4ddd0c1068ae
address
bc1qtzs9wlql22lqqh4h9wgjdd033kxj7ef03yzhsz02aaxa6rqsdzhqvh4pj2
transaction
88e86b33c23d521508bf45a15c42935bb160a5ac602e03b30cd73401ad808e4e
spent
true